Beirut, Dec 6: Major General Roman Gofman was on Thursday appointed as the new head of the Mossad by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u, who selected him after interviewing several candidates for the crucial intelligence post. According to media reports, Netanyahu chose Maj. Gen. Gofman to lead the Mossadās intelligence and special operations, entrusting him with one of Israelās most sensitive and strategically important roles. Gofman, who currently serves as the military secretary to the Israeli Prime Minister, will succeed Mossad Director David Barnea, whose term concludes in June 2026.
